By "mainstream" I mean: AWS qualifications, EWF certifications, IIW qualifications CSWIP certifications The declaration above is rather generalized, therefore it is best for you to make sure which credentials are acknowledged in the territory that you intend to work in. If you desire to function globally, after that primarily accreditations from any one of the organizations listed above would qualify you for welding inspector work.

Please note that it is not feasible to come to be a professional in all welding codes. There are way way too many. If you are presently a Welder as well as you intend to start acquiring direct exposure to welding codes so that you can prepare yourself for a life as a welding assessor, then I suggest you concentrate on the following codes: ASME IX: This is tailored to the welding of pressurized devices such as piping as well as pressure vessels.

1: This is tailored towards architectural steelwork. American based, yet widely used worldwide. API 1104: This is tailored towards pipeline welding. American based. Use reasonably commonly, although pipeline codes do tend to have a more local bias. Much of the much more local pipe welding codes are freely based on API 1104, so a great basis to have.

High Quality Equipments Understanding Central to the work of the welding examiner is the quality control and also control function - welding shops near me. This is not only based on technical welding expertise, however also quality systems understanding. Within this component of your work you will obtain to deal a lot with high quality management system criteria such as the ISO 9000 series of requirements, and additionally the ISO 3834 series of requirements.

The Ultimate Guide To Arc Welder

Quality Guarantee (QA) and also High Quality Control (QC) are greatly driven by recorded systems as well as depend on papers as well as documents to have traceability as well as an auditable system. All of this will be central to your work as welding inspector. If you are excessively daunted by documents, after that you might not delight in the life of a welding examiner.
